Karachi can’t bear monsoon more than 80mm

Karachi is able to deal with monsoon spells if the city gets 70 to 80 mm of rain, however, it would be a challenge for the institutions otherwise, said the Karachi Administration Laeeq Ahmed.


Karachi Metropolitan Corporation (KMC) has prepared a plan to avert any tragic situation ahead of city’s monsoon spell, said the Karachi administration Laeeq Ahmed.


The statement came after his recent visit to Shahrah e Faisal, Karsaz, Liaquatabad, Nazimabad and many other of city area after an unexpected spell hit on Monday morning.


25 new de-watering pumps have been added in the city, increasing the strength of the previous de-watering pumps which have been installed at all underpasses by KMC, he added.


“KMC will use machinery and manpower of cantonment boards, the Pakistan Navy, and Pakistan Disaster Management Authority in time of need,” said Laeeq.

Moreover, the institution has established three teams to deal with the rain water, while 514 small and 38 big stormwaters are being cleaned.


It has issued notices to the cattle markets to take necessary measurements ahead of monsoon spells.
